On another note… the Archdiocese of Cincinnati has issued a detailed list of inappropriate behaviors for priests, saying they should not kiss, tickle or wrestle children.  The newest version of the archdiocese’s Decree on Child Protection also prohibits bear hugs, lap-sitting and piggyback rides. Acceptable behavior:  priests may still shake children’s hands, pat them on the back and give high-fives. Hmmm…
